KIND OF ANIMAL: Bird


FOOD
The ibis loves seafood.
It eats fish, shellfish, crabs and shrimp.
It also eats frogs and lizards.

ENEMIES
People drain the water from swamps so that they can build houses.
This means that the ibises that live there lose their homes.

WHERE THEY LIVE
The ibis likes wet and muddy places.
It lives near lakes, marshes and swamps.
It also lives on shores.

 

DID YOU KNOW?
  • The ibis has a long bill, a long neck and legs like stilts. It is good at catching things that live in water that isn’t very deep.
  • The ibis has beautiful thick, white feathers.
